1 | PRODUCT DESCRIPTION | ABTEC Rubber Forte effectively controls the abnormal leaf fall disease and dry root rot of rubber plants caused by Phytophthora sp. It is only available in wettable powder formulation. |
2 | ORGANISM & COUNT | A consortium of bio - fungicides. 2 × 108 cfu/g. |
3 | MODE OF ACTION | The affected leaves and fruits of rubber will contain numerous spores of Phytophthora which then reaches the soil through shed leaves and fruits. These male and female zoospores will then combine together to form Oospores, which can survive in the soil for 2 years under unfavorable conditions. When the monsoon starts these oospores develop into sporangium which then generates zoospores which can be carried through wind and affects new leaves and fruits. Thus the cycle continues. The microbial consortium present in ABTEC Rubber Forte prevents the germination of Oospores and Zoospores of Phytophthora sp., present in the soil,thus effectively breaking the cycle. These microbes prevents the spores from reaching the sporangium stage in the soil itself. |
4 | MOST EFFECTIVE AGAINST | Phytophthora medea, Phytophthora palmivora |

5 | DOSAGE & METHOD OF APPLICATION | ABTEC Rubber Forte is used for broadcasting in rubber plantations before and after the onset of monsoon. Don’t mix ABTEC Rubber Forte along with chemical fungicides/pesticides, and keep a gap of 15 days after the chemical application. Broadcasting / Soil Application: Mix 6 kg of ABTEC Rubber Forte with 30 kg of ABTEC Bio - Organics for Rubber / ABTEC Super Organic Manure / ABTEC Cowdung and broadcast in one acre of rubber plantation before the onset of monsoon on May - June. Apply the second dose of 3 kg ABTEC Rubber Forte mixed with 50 kg ABTEC Bio - Organics for Rubber / acre on September - October. |
